Abstract
A full-length cDNA library from the pericarp of Minhua 6 peanut was constructed based on switching mechanism at 5′end of RNA transcript(SMART) system.The purified double strand cDNA was ligated to SfiⅠ digested vector pDNR-LIB,and transformed into DH5α by electroporation.The entry library constructed has a high titer of 1.3×107 cfu.PCR results showed that the inserts varied from 750 to 2000 bp with average size larger than 1000 bp and 95.5% of recombinant percentage.As results bioinformatics analysis,about 68% of sequences were full-length.Thirteen sequences with known functions were identified by BlastX searched against the NCBI non-redundant protein databases.These results will be useful for screening and cloning pericarp special expression genes and adding genetic information for peanut.
